Study how air pollution affects youth development
Part of Mental health clinical trials.
This study looks at whether exposure to air pollution during youth is linked to how children grow, learn, or develop. You may be invited if your family is already part of an earlier birth cohort study and can complete questionnaires and (if needed) brain imaging safely.

Who can take part
- You must be enrolled in the BYS-ECHO birth cohort study (the earlier parent study)
- You (and at least one parent) must speak English or Spanish
- A parent must be eligible for the parent part of the study and agree to participate
- You should not have a serious neurological condition (for example, seizure disorder)
- You must be able to have an MRI safely (no permanent metal and no issues that make MRI unsafe)
- You should not have severe fear of enclosed spaces (claustrophobia)
